Flat homes in TW11

842 sales over the last 5 years — 48% of all TW11 transactions.

£445,000
Median price (5y)
842
Flat sales
-3.5%
Year-on-year

One natural paragraph, no keyword stuffing: a flat home in TW11 sold for a median £445,000 over the past five years across 842 transactions. That makes flats 48% of the outcode's residential market. All figures come straight from HM Land Registry Price Paid Data under the Open Government Licence v3.0.

How flats in TW11 compare

The same five-year median, set against the rest of TW11 and the national figure for this property type.

vs all TW11 property
This outcode × type£445,000
Comparison£770,248
−£325,248 discount
vs national flat median
This outcode × type£445,000
Comparison£230,000
+£215,000 premium
